# Sproutline Environments

Sproutline is the plant-watering scheduler behind the Fernholt greenhouse kiosks. Three environments: dev, staging, prod. Dev resets nightly and uses simulated moisture sensors. Staging mirrors prod hardware with a single test bed. Prod drives real valves — changes require a second approver. Deploys go dev → staging → prod, no skipping. Staging soak is 24 hours minimum. Current prod settings, which staging must match exactly before promotion, are as follows.

deployment values, kagag-fadup:
druath:
  log_level: warn
  metrics_host: metrics.druath.qorvellabs.internal
  pool_size: 8

Finance Review — Calyx Launch Plan. The Calyx One launch budget stands at 2.1M, weighted to channel incentives and a six-week media burst in the Derwell region. Break-even modelled at month nine assuming 7% attach rate; sensitivity shows month fourteen if attach drops to 4%. Inventory commitments are staged, limiting write-off risk. Heads of department should confirm headcount asks by Friday. One open dependency: packaging supplier pricing. Strategic rationale for the timing is set out in the note below.

confidential, kagup-bafog: Fraaxax Group is in early talks to buy Soroxox Group for about $343.8 million. The Olidor launch date is June 14, and nothing goes to the press before then. Legal wants the Aldmirek Logistics term sheet signed before July 23.

## 2.8.0 — Cron Migration and Key Rotation

All scheduled jobs formerly run by the legacy cron host have moved to the Wrenflow workflow engine. As part of this migration, the signing key used by the nightly archival job was rotated; the old key is revoked and must not appear in any config. New workflow definitions must be signed with the key below.

deploy key for kahof-tadup: bky4_rRMZ